Research Abstract

It remains unknown effects of all-trans retinoic acid (ATRA) on FGF23 expression/secretion in bone tissue. I therefore examined those effects using supernatants, mRNA and protein from human osteoblast culture. However, I couldn't observe the alteration of expression/secretion because FGF23 was not expressed in human osteoblasts we used.
